11.2 Code list
11.2.1 Parameter codes
Code Display, values
[default setting]
Description
Note:
Codes marked by an asterisk (*) indicate that the positioner needs to be re-initialized after-
wards
P0 Status reading with
basic information
The reading indicates the valve position or angle of rotation in %
when the positioner is initialized.
On touching
when the positioner is not initialized, the position
of the lever in relation to the mid-axis is displayed.
P1 Reading direction The reading direction of the display is turned by 180°.
P2* ATO/ATC
[ATO]
Parameter to adapt the positioner to how the valve functions:
ATO: Air to open (valve CLOSED in fail-safe position),
ATC. Air to close (valve OPEN in fail-safe position)
P3* Pin position
17/25/[35]/50/90°
Insert follower pin in the proper position depending on the valve
travel/opening angle (select according to travel tables on
page20).
P4* Nominal range
[MAX]
Values with
default setting [35]:
e.g.
7.5/8.92/10.6/12.6/
15.0/17.8/21.2mm
Firmware 1.03 and lower:
The possible adjustment range can be selected in stages depend-
ing on the selected pin position:
17 From 3.75 to 10.6mm
25 From 5.3 to 15.0mm
35 From 7.5 to 21.2mm
50 From 10.6 to 30.0mm
For 90°: Maximum range only, if P3 = 90°
MAX: Maximum possible travel
Nominal range
[MAX]
Firmware 1.10 and higher:
The possible adjustment range can be selected in steps of 0.5mm
depending on the selected pin position:
17 From 3.5 to 11.0mm , alternatively MAX (up to 18.0mm)
25 From 5.0 to 16.0mm , alternatively MAX (up to 25.0mm)
35 From 7.0 to 22.0mm , alternatively MAX (up to 35.0mm)
50 From 10.0 to 32.0mm , alternatively MAX (up to 50.0mm)
For 90°: Maximum range only, if P3 = 90°
MAX: Maximum possible travel
